We all have problems. Relationship. Family. School. Work. Kids. Health. In-laws. Money.
This viral perspective has a powerful way of grounding us when life feels overwhelming. It instantly shifts our focus from what we lack or what is stressing us out, to realizing that the struggles we know and understand are often better than the unknown battles of others.
Here are a few ways to channel this mindset shift when you’re having a heavy day:
Normalize the unseen: Remind yourself that every person you pass is dealing with hidden battles, grief, or exhaustion. Your struggles don’t mean you are failing; they mean you are human.
Practice active gratitude: Instead of focusing on perfection, try keeping a quick mental tally of 2 or 3 things going right. It helps quiet the noise of day-to-day stress.
Embrace your own journey: Your battles have shaped the uniquely strong, resilient version of you that exists today
